Buxus x. 'Green Mountain'

Choose Green Mountain Boxwood if you want a formal evergreen with upright shape for entries, corners, or ordered foundation beds. The tradeoff: it needs occasional pruning to stay sharp and is not the soft, rounded look some yards need.

PGNE Report Card

Category Grade Why
Landscape Impact A- Its upright pyramidal form gives strong structure without needing constant shaping.
Growth Rate B It fills in at a steady pace, but it is not the fastest boxwood for quick results.
Maintenance B Plan on light pruning and airflow-minded planting to keep the shape clean.
Deer Resistance A- Boxwood is a strong pick where browsing is a concern, though no plant should be treated as untouchable.
Small Space Fit B- It works in tighter beds only if you want height and are willing to prune.
Screening Value C+ It can block sightlines in pieces, but it is better for structure than a true privacy screen.

Compare It To

Green Velvet Boxwood

Choose Green Mountain Boxwood for upright structure; choose Green Velvet Boxwood for a lower, rounded foundation plant.

Dee Runk Boxwood

Choose Dee Runk Boxwood when you need a narrower column; choose Green Mountain Boxwood when a broader pyramid fits the bed better.

Green Mountain Boxwood - Hedge Pruned

Choose Green Mountain Boxwood - Hedge Pruned if you want a more finished hedge look on day one; choose this pyramidal form for individual accents.

Our Experience

At PGNE, we'd typically recommend Green Mountain when the homeowner wants order and height without using a tall, narrow evergreen. Give it room, prune lightly, and avoid crowding it against the house.

Customers Usually Ask

Will it stay pyramidal on its own?

Mostly, yes, but light pruning keeps the outline cleaner.

Is it good by a front door?

Yes, if the space can handle an upright formal shrub.

Can it be used as a hedge?

Yes, but choose Green Mountain Boxwood - Hedge Pruned for a head start.
